目录
1、系统要求
图书信息管理系统需要实现管理员、用户的登录和注册功能,管理员可对图书信息进行添加、删除、修改、查询功能,用户可在系统对图书进行按书名、按书号、按作者姓名三种方式查询功能。系统以MySQL数据库技术为支撑,对所有图书、用户、管理员信息进行数据存储。
- 用户登录从用户信息表中查询所输入的用户名和密码是否与表中某条记录对应字段完全匹配,登录成功后隐藏登录界面。
- 用户注册时用户名不能与系统中已存在的重复,用户密码按黑点显示,要求输入两次密码,两次必须一致,此外还要填写性别和邮箱;管理员注册需要验证密钥。
- 添加图书时,若书号重复,添加失败。
- 减少图书数量时,若减少数量大于库存数量,则直接删除图书。
2、系统环境
项目软件:Visual Studio 2012
数据库:MySQL Server 5.5
环境搭建插件:mysql-connector-net-6.6.6
3、Visual Studio 2012 连接MySQL
1)mysql-connector-net-6.6.6下载
2)mysql-connector-net-6.6.6安装
双击程序——点击Next——选择安装类型Typical——点击install进行安装
安装包完成下载mysql.data.dll位置:
C:\Program Files (x86)\MySQL\MySQL Connector Net 6.6.6\Assemblies\v4.0
3)Visual Studio 2012 连接MySQL
- 在VS2012项目内,引用mysql.data.dll文件
打开VS2012项目——项目——添加引用——浏览——选择mysql.data.dll位置——添加——确定
- 使用using来调用mysql连接
导入命名空间 using MySql.Data.MySqlClient;